tmorriso Posted September 3, 2016 Posted September 3, 2016 I've used Draft Buddy for years, but not while tracking a live draft. I want to use it this year and it will work, but I am seeing some odd behavior in the spreadsheet. When I click the Draft Player button, it processes the selection, but the page rearranges itself. See the image linked below (I can't embed the image apparently). The top image is before I press the Draft Player button; the bottom image is after I press it. The buttons change position and the FFtoday and Draft Buddy graphics are now blocking the player list. The buttons still work and if I select a different tab and then go back, everything is in place again. This happens on all the pages with the Draft Player button. It will work as it is, but in the middle of a draft I would prefer not to deal with it. I am running Excel 2013 on Windows 10. I tried Excel 2013 on Windows 7 with the same result. https://s18.postimg.org/6okr7qxex/DB_Problem.jpg Quote
Mike MacGregor Posted September 4, 2016 Posted September 4, 2016 I think this is a screen refresh issue. Normally when you draft a player it copies the player to the draft report tab. We arent supposed to see it because the screen should freeze and do it in the background. Something not working quite right on your system however. Do you have a lot of other things open at the same time as Excel with Draft Buddy that might be taking up memory, causing the computer to run a little slow? Quote
Mike MacGregor Posted September 4, 2016 Posted September 4, 2016 Same result, different computers and different monitors? Quote
tmorriso Posted September 4, 2016 Author Posted September 4, 2016 Yes, the same result on different computers with completely different hardware, including display adapters and monitors. I will check if I still have a computer with Office 2010 around. My son's PC is new and pretty high end. I'll try it on his. Quote
tmorriso Posted September 4, 2016 Author Posted September 4, 2016 I just ran it on my laptop and it worked as expected. That is Excel 2016/Windows 10, but there is common factor between the two desktop computers I tried earlier. Both are running the monitors off displayport while the laptop outputs to an hdmi connection. This isn't the first issue that displayport has caused. Since the laptop is what I will be using for my draft on Tuesday I am good to go and you don't need to follow up. Thanks. Quote

madstrk Posted September 6, 2016 Posted September 6, 2016 I have this problem on two computers, one running windows 7, the other Windows 10. Both using Office/Excel 2013. It happens only after compiling the cheatsheet from the "5. action" tab. It goes to about 25% CPU usage and 2300 MB memory, and never returns lower. It doesn't happen all, the time, but most of the time. Even happens on 2015 version of Draft Buddy. Work around after a cheatshet compile is to: save Draft Buddy workbook & exit Excel check task manager and you may need "end task" on excel restart Draft Buddy workbook Is there a better fix?
